Hopkins Awards

The E. L. and Z. Irene Hopkins Foundation has established awards to recognize the outstanding performance of Emporia teachers and school support staff.

Nomination forms are available at all Emporia public schools and the Mary Herbert Education Center, 1700 West 7th. Forms are also available on the district’s website. Nominations can be submitted by students, parents, and co-workers. The deadline for entries is March 10 and nominations are limited to current staff in the Emporia Public Schools.

For further information, please contact Kristy Turner at 341-2201 or kturner@usd253.org.

We believe that . . .


1. Everyone deserves to be treated with respect and dignity.

2. All children are capable of learning and deserve the right to receive a quality education.

3. We must appreciate and learn from the diversity in our community.

4. There are common values and beliefs across cultures on which we can build.

5. Everyone needs to be a lifelong learner.

6. By working together, we can make our community a better place.

7. It is okay to disagree as long as we respect each other.

8. Joy and laughter are important.

9. Parents/guardians should be active partners in the educational process.

10. School should be a safe and secure environment.

11. Success is measured both qualitatively and quantitatively.

12. The goal of teaching is learning.

13. Quality education takes wise investment of people, resources, time and money.

14. A positive learning environment encourages our students to be involved.

15. Everyone should have their basic needs met.
